Skip to content

Commit 9ac14b4

Browse files
authored
Revise README for project overview and open source info
Updated project introduction and added open source declaration.
1 parent 22ea21c commit 9ac14b4

File tree

1 file changed

+16
-3
lines changed

1 file changed

+16
-3
lines changed

README.md

Lines changed: 16 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,10 +1,14 @@
11
# fnTv-vlcProxy
22

3-
## 📖 简介
3+
## 📖 项目简介
44
  这是一个用Go语言编写的第三方飞牛影视客户端fntv-client-multiplatform项目的VLC播放器代理桥接程序,程序充当代理角色,同时兼容飞牛影视的HTTP及HTTPS连接请求,用于解决调用VLC播放器连接飞牛影视服务器时不能传递如cookie等自定义请求头的问题。
55

66
  第三方跨平台飞牛影视客户端项目地址:[fntv-client-multiplatform](https://github.com/FNOSP/fntv-client-multiplatform)
77

8+
## 🌟 开源声明
9+
10+
  本项目开源,希望能为开发者们搭建超棒且友好的社区氛围,为你的开发之路加满灵感 buff~ 若你刚好有类似开发需求,想要学习或使用本项目,记得遵守开源社区规范,fork+star 本项目安排上,一起玩转开发呀~
11+
812
## ✨ 功能特点
913

1014
- 🌐 在本地启动HTTP服务接收来自VLC的请求
@@ -50,6 +54,14 @@ go build -o vlc-proxy
5054
curl -X POST -d "url=http://192.168.1.200:5666&cookie=Trim-MC-token=2a075b3438764b4da9e772c66a759548; lastLoginUsername=admin" http://127.0.0.1:1999/proxyInfo
5155
```
5256

57+
### 👁 获取代理参数
58+
发送Get请求到`/proxyGet`接口
59+
60+
示例:
61+
```bash
62+
curl http://127.0.0.1:1999/proxyGet
63+
```
64+
5365
### 📺 VLC播放设置
5466

5567
在VLC中设置播放地址为本地代理服务地址,例如:
@@ -66,7 +78,8 @@ http://192.168.1.200:5666/v/media/ac611442ed3fb17daa73e71bc1268d02/preset.m3u8
6678

6779
## ⚠️ 注意事项
6880

69-
- 本程序仅用于适配飞牛影视服务的VLC播放器代理,其他影视服务器不支持!
70-
- 确保目标服务器地址正确且可访问
81+
- 本程序仅用于适配第三方飞牛影视客户端fntv-client-multiplatform项目连接飞牛影视服务的VLC播放器代理桥接
82+
- 其他影视客户端不支持,如有需要请参照原客户端项目逻辑进行调用
83+
- 确保目标飞牛影视服务器地址正确且可以直接访问(不支持基于FN Connect服务地址的飞牛影视服务)
7184
- Cookie信息需要完整,包括所有必要的键值对
7285
- 程序会保留原始请求的大部分HTTP头部信息(除Host外)

0 commit comments

Comments
 (0)